Uparginia Population - Sundargarh, Orissa
Uparginia is a medium size village located in Mahulapada Block of Sundargarh district, Orissa with total 162 families residing. The Uparginia village has population of 697 of which 334 are males while 363 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Uparginia village population of children with age 0-6 is 153 which makes up 21.95 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Uparginia village is 1087 which is higher than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Uparginia as per census is 1068, higher than Orissa average of 941.
Uparginia village has lower liter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Uparginia village was 25.55 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Uparginia Male literacy stands at 36.54 % while female literacy rate was 15.49 %.

Uparginia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 162 | - | - |
Population | 697 | 334 | 363 |
Child (0-6) | 153 | 74 | 79 |
Schedule Caste | 11 | 7 | 4 |
Schedule Tribe | 666 | 317 | 349 |
Literacy | 25.55 % | 36.54 % | 15.49 % |
Total Workers | 336 | 194 | 142 |
Main Worker | 30 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 306 | 171 | 135 |
